Re: How can I prepare for engineering service exam? I have scored 50% marks
You can try for ESE exam conducted by UPSC. Gap in studies is not going to affect your eligibility.The exam covers topics on general aptitude test, and engineering. Preparation for the exam can be started after collecting exam pattern and detailed exam syllabus. Reference books are different for different subjects. The exm is conducted in subjects of civil/mechanical/electronics/electrical engineering.
